    Starting Off - Toms' First Match


    Saturday 26th Sep 2009

    Tom's day finally arrived and we spent an hour at home going through all his tackle, rigs, rods and everything he thought he needed with a few reminders from me. He was pretty nervous, which was quite reasonable considering the field of anglers he was just about to meet and fish with - this included a fully start studded field of Home International Anglers, not a bad starter in your Shore Match Fishing career!
    First stop was Dorset Fishing Rods, where Richard handed us a custom built Conifers Bare Bones Bass rod. Given to Moonfleet Angling to use for coaching sessions. Massive thanks to Richard!

    Starting Off - Tom Houlton, The Conger Angler !


    Tom and Ian headed off for Blue Anchor in search of Conger on Saturday and opted for the beach itself as apposed to the wall. There would be little for Tom to gain fishing a wall and possibly having to hand line a conger up. Tom Set up for both Ian and himself and as we had 2 hours to kill before fishing started we went through some rigs. Tom was pretty much confident with what he would need to use for bait, and the rigs needed for the day. He started off with a simple 3 hook flapper on size 6 hooks and went for pin whiting.

    Starting Off - Tom Houlton Sea Angler !


    Anyone who has read the Llangennith thread in the Shoreangler Forum regarding my boy and his heroics will have read that he is an utter novice. Following the events of that day he has decided that fishing is a pretty exciting sport, and as such is now pestering the life out of me for info, tactics and trips to the beach. It seems by my son, Tom, is Starting Off his Shore Angling and I've set him a target - Fish a match, but not just any match, the England Junior Squad Fundraiser.

    The England Junior squad fundraiser is on 26th Sep. It is going to be fished by some pretty impressive anglers from the International and Regional Leagues plus some very handy local Club Anglers. It should prove to be a good experience for Tom and you can follow the progress in this feature. Please read on:
